Germany urges Bulgarians to vote in EP elections

Photo: BTA

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of Foreign Affairs Ekaterina Zaharieva and Germany’s Foreign Minister Heiko Maas held a closed-door meeting at the Council of Ministers. They discussed the development of the Western Balkans.

“It is a region with unresolved issues, but it is a region in the heart of Europe that holds promise,” Ekaterina Zaharieva said. Heiko Maas conveyed a message to Bulgarians: “Bulgaria is a strong pro-European partner. I would like to urge all citizens to go out and vote. We want to stake on cooperation, not to submit to populists and nationalists.”
